The flight from Singapore Changi Airport (SIN) to Goa Dabolim International Airport (GOI) covers 3,658 km (2,273 miles) and takes approximately 4h 58m gate to gate for a typical jet.

The route heads north-west on an initial great-circle bearing of 297°, passing near 8.7° N, 89.2° E at its midpoint.

How this is worked out

  1. Take both airports' published coordinates from OurAirports — nothing here is scraped from another flight site.
  2. Great-circle distance by haversine on a mean earth radius of 6,371.0088 km: 3,658 km.
  3. Airborne time = that distance ÷ 805 km/h, a representative jet cruise speed: 4h 33m.
  4. Add a flat 25 minutes for pushback, taxi, climb, descent and taxi-in — the reason a 400 km hop is never half an hour: 4h 58m gate to gate.
  5. Winds, aircraft type and airline schedule padding are not modelled. The cruise-speed table shows how much that assumption is worth.
3,658 km / 805 km/h = 4h 33m airborne
            + 25 min ground = 4h 58m gate to gate

Flight time at different cruise speeds

Aircraft type, winds and routing all move the real number. This is the same distance flown at different speeds, plus the 25-minute ground and climb allowance.

Typical ofCruise speedAirborneGate to gate
Turboprop / regional550 km/h6h 39m7h 04m
Narrowbody jet (A320, 737)780 km/h4h 41m5h 07m
Widebody jet (777, 787, A350)900 km/h4h 04m4h 29m
Private jet (Gulfstream)850 km/h4h 18m4h 43m

Headwinds on an eastbound long-haul routinely add 30–60 minutes; the same route westbound can be quicker. Airlines publish schedules with padding built in.

How far is Singapore from Vasco da Gama?

3,658 kilometres in a straight line over the earth's surface — 2,273 miles or 1,975 nautical miles. Actual flown distance is usually 2–5% longer because aircraft follow airways, avoid weather and route around restricted airspace.
